引言
随着人工智能技术的飞速发展,大模型API已经成为了许多企业和个人提升工作效率的重要工具。本文将深入探讨大模型API在文件处理方面的应用,帮助读者了解如何利用这些API解锁智能办公的新篇章。
大模型API概述
什么是大模型API?
大模型API是指通过云端或本地部署的强大模型,提供一系列预定义的接口,允许用户通过简单的调用实现复杂的任务。这些模型通常基于深度学习技术,经过大量数据训练,能够处理文本、图像、语音等多种类型的数据。
大模型API的特点
- 强大的处理能力:大模型API能够处理复杂的任务,如文本摘要、图像识别、语音转文本等。
- 易用性:API接口通常设计简单,用户可以通过编程语言轻松调用。
- 灵活性:用户可以根据自己的需求调整模型参数,实现个性化定制。
文件处理应用
文本文件处理
文本摘要
from transformers import pipeline
# 创建文本摘要模型
summarizer = pipeline("summarization")
# 调用API进行文本摘要
text = "本文介绍了大模型API在文件处理方面的应用,包括文本摘要、图像识别、语音转文本等。"
summary = summarizer(text, max_length=150, min_length=30, do_sample=False)
print(summary[0]['summary_text'])
文本分类
from sklearn.feature_extraction.text import TfidfVectorizer
from sklearn.naive_bayes import MultinomialNB
from sklearn.pipeline import make_pipeline
# 创建文本分类模型
model = make_pipeline(TfidfVectorizer(), MultinomialNB())
# 训练模型
data = [
("文件处理", "本文介绍了大模型API在文件处理方面的应用"),
("图像识别", "大模型API在图像识别领域的应用"),
("语音转文本", "语音转文本技术及其应用")
]
model.fit([text for _, text in data], [label for _, label in data])
# 分类
predicted_label = model.predict([text])
print(predicted_label)
图像文件处理
图像识别
from PIL import Image
import requests
import json
# 图像识别API URL
url = "https://api.imagerecognition.com/recognize"
# 调用API进行图像识别
image = Image.open("example.jpg")
image_bytes = requests.post(url, files={"image": image})
# 解析结果
result = json.loads(image_bytes.text)
print(result)
语音文件处理
语音转文本
from pydub import AudioSegment
# 读取语音文件
audio = AudioSegment.from_file("example.wav")
# 转换为文本
text = audio.to_text()
print(text)
总结
大模型API在文件处理方面的应用已经越来越广泛,为智能办公带来了巨大的便利。通过本文的介绍,相信读者已经对大模型API在文件处理方面的应用有了更深入的了解。未来,随着技术的不断发展,大模型API将在更多领域发挥重要作用。
